Transaction 73ca51ced16245f4dc95d2a423bc9d8b71a604a1565c2ef6f2923e3425dbb5a8

1 Input
2 Outputs
  • 73ca51ced16245f4dc95d2a423bc9d8b71a604a1565c2ef6f2923e3425dbb5a8:0
  • value  7000000
    address  1MFFAsWfZ9D3bMYR4HL2huP37KG97viU69
  • 73ca51ced16245f4dc95d2a423bc9d8b71a604a1565c2ef6f2923e3425dbb5a8:1
  • value  10691384
    address  1dXAwa9vfshg79cXf1JFiCrAhKzoibKRZ